Subject: [RFC PATCH v1 2/3] apei: add ghes param for arch_apei_report_mem_error

Hi Borislav,
On 2017/9/1 19:15, Borislav Petkov wrote:
> n Fri, Sep 01, 2017 at 06:32:00PM +0800, Xie XiuQi wrote:
>> Add ghes param for arch_apei_report_mem_error, with which
>> we could do more arch-specific processing.
>>
>> Signed-off-by: Xie XiuQi <xiexiuqi@huawei.com>
>> ---
>> arch/x86/kernel/acpi/apei.c | 2 +-
>> drivers/acpi/apei/apei-base.c | 4 +++-
>> drivers/acpi/apei/ghes.c | 2 +-
>> include/acpi/apei.h | 4 +++-
>> include/acpi/ghes.h | 3 ++-
>> 5 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)
>>
>> di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/acpi/apei.c b/arch/x86/kernel/acpi/apei.c
>> index ea3046e..1bf1c9b 100644
>> --- a/arch/x86/kernel/acpi/apei.c
>> +++ b/arch/x86/kernel/acpi/apei.c
>> @@ -46,7 +46,7 @@ int arch_apei_enable_cmcff(struct acpi_hest_header *hest_hdr, void *data)
>> return 1;
>> }
>>
>> -void arch_apei_report_mem_error(int sev, struct cper_sec_mem_err *mem_err)
>> +void arch_apei_report_mem_error(struct ghes *ghes, int sev, struct cper_sec_mem_err *mem_err)
>> {
>> #ifdef CONFIG_X86_MCE
>> apei_mce_report_mem_error(sev, mem_err);
>> diff --git a/drivers/acpi/apei/apei-base.c b/drivers/acpi/apei/apei-base.c
>> index da370e1..317169b 100644
>> --- a/drivers/acpi/apei/apei-base.c
>> +++ b/drivers/acpi/apei/apei-base.c
>> @@ -38,6 +38,8 @@
>> #include <linux/debugfs.h>
>> #include <asm/unaligned.h>
>>
>> +#include <acpi/ghes.h>
>> +
>> #include "apei-internal.h"
>>
>> #define APEI_PFX "APEI: "
>> @@ -770,7 +772,7 @@ int __weak arch_apei_enable_cmcff(struct acpi_hest_header *hest_hdr,
>> }
>> E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(arch_apei_enable_cmcff);
>>
>> -void __weak arch_apei_report_mem_error(int sev,
>> +void __weak arch_apei_report_mem_error(struct ghes *ghes, int sev,
>> struct cper_sec_mem_err *mem_err)
>> {
>> }
>> diff --git a/drivers/acpi/apei/ghes.c b/drivers/acpi/apei/ghes.c
>> index fa9400d..996d16c4 100644
>> --- a/drivers/acpi/apei/ghes.c
>> +++ b/drivers/acpi/apei/ghes.c
>> @@ -483,7 +483,7 @@ static void ghes_do_proc(struct ghes *ghes,
>>
>> ghes_edac_report_mem_error(ghes, sev, mem_err);
>>
>> - arch_apei_report_mem_error(sev, mem_err);
>> + arch_apei_report_mem_error(ghes, sev, mem_err);
>
> And next time you want to pass something else, you'll have to touch all
> those files again...
>
> Instead, make that a notifier to which consumers register and define
> a separate struct mem_err or ghes_err or whatnot and populate it with
> cper_sec_mem_err data and whatever else is needed by the consumers.
> Instead of passing that struct ghes * which consumers don't need to
> know.
OK, I'll add a notify chain here, thanks.
